The first stop is almost guaranteed to be Pena Palace, perched high on a hill, offering spectacular panoramic views of Sintra and beyond. The palace’s vibrant colors and fairy-tale architecture make it a photographer’s dream. Inside, you’ll find vibrant chambers and lush gardens to explore. Reviewers highlight the breathtaking vistas and quirky architecture, making this a must-see.
Next, you’ll visit Quinta da Regaleira, a site renowned for esoteric symbolism and enchanting architecture. The gardens with initiatic wells and grottoes provide a sense of discovering hidden worlds. Many appreciated the intricate symbolism and intriguing design, which invites visitors to imagine the stories behind each corner. Some noted that the garden areas are quite expansive, so comfortable shoes are a must.
In the latter part of your journey, you’ll have time to wander through the charming streets of Sintra’s historic center. Expect to find quaint shops, local cafes, and the famous Travesseiro de Sintra, a sweet pastry that many reviewers rave about. The village’s medieval charm is evident in its narrow cobbled streets and colorful buildings. This is an excellent opportunity to soak up the authentic atmosphere and perhaps pick up some souvenirs.
